Performance balls featuring Chemical Friction Technology
After extensive research, development, and lab and field tests, Brunswick
is proud to introduce the new C•(System) 2.5 bowling ball, developed in
close collaboration with Hall of Fame bowler Carmen Salvino. In addition
to being a legendary bowler, Salvino has studied what makes a bowling ball
react and experimented to create advanced technology materials and holds
multiple patents related to bowling ball design.
This new line of performance bowling balls features Chemical Friction Technology
(CFT). As Salvino explains, "The coverstock was chemically designed to have
shaped molecular structures that produce a high coefficient of friction.
Because of the shape of the molecule, when the ball goes into rolling friction,
which occurs at the back part of the lane, slippage is eliminated and the
ball will give you maximum entry and carry. This is the advantage of chemical
friction versus mechanical friction."
"The chemistry is versatile enough that even if sanded or polished, it will
not change the shape of the molecule. That is the uniqueness of this chemistry."
NEW C•(System) 3.5 – NEW Chemical Friction Technology coverstock For medium
to oily lane conditions.
Coverstock: Chemical Friction Technology (CFT) 3.5
CFT 3.5 is the next evolution in Chemical Friction Technology. The CFT
3.5 coverstock has a higher friction factor than the original CFT 2.5, which
quickens the response time, improves down lane traction and increases the
overall hook.
Core: I-Block: The proven two-component asymmetrical I-Block core
enhances the CFT 3.5 coverstock to create maximum forgiveness, strong entry
angles along with versatile drilling layouts.
Reaction Characteristics:
Ball Motion: With its 4000-grit micro pad finish, the C·(System) 3.5 offers
a higher friction factor and increased response time to friction alternative
than the original C·(System) 2.5. The new C·(System) 3.5 is best used on
medium-oily to oily lane conditions when a quicker response motion is needed
to increase entry angle to the pocket.

- Release Date: Jan/25/2010
- Coverstock: CFT (Chemical Friction
Technology) 3.5 Reactive
- Color: Purple/Yellow (Actual
ball color may vary.)
- Weight Block: (14-16#) I-Block
Two-component Asymmetrical Core
- Hardness: 75-76
- Ball Finish: 4000 grit Micro
Pad
- Core Dynamics @ 16lbs:
RG Max: 2.570"
RG Min: 2.520"
RG Diff: 0.050"
RG asym: 0.017
RG Avg: 4.4 of 10
RG Int: 2.553
- Hook Potential: 170 (10 to 175
scale)
- Length: 100 (25 to 235 scale)
- Breakpoint Shape: 95 Angular
(Scale Smooth Arc 10-Angular 100)
- Best Lane Conditions: Medium
to Oily lane conditions
